MMA Junkie reports that Thiago Silva’s contract with the UFC has been terminated. Silva was arrested after a standoff with Florida police at his home after an altercation at a BJJ gym and a domestic dispute involving his wife. The MMA Report has the details from the police report. MMA lobbies in Albany…again
In a story that seems to repeat itself, MMA advocates were in Albany Tuesday starting its annual bid to legalize mixed martial arts in New York State according to the USA Today. UFC gets denied at Super Bowl Media Day
The New Jersey Star-Ledger reports that the UFC was turned away at the NFL’s Super Bowl Media Day on Tuesday. NFL officials chased down UFC reps trying to obtain pictures of NFL players wearing the UFC Championship belt.
